General Description
5-CHLORO-4-ETHYL-2-HYDROXYBENZENESULFONIC ACID is a chemical compound with the molecular formula C8H9ClO4S. It is an organic compound that belongs to the class of sulfonic acids. This chemical is a white crystalline solid that is soluble in water. It is commonly used as an intermediate in the synthesis of pharmaceuticals and dyes. Additionally, it has applications in the manufacturing of polymers, agrochemicals, and other industrial products. The presence of a chlorine atom and an ethyl group in its structure gives it unique chemical properties that make it suitable for various chemical reactions and processes.
Check Digit Verification of cas no
The CAS Registry Mumber 104207-29-6 includes 9 digits separated into 3 groups by hyphens. The first part of the number,starting from the left, has 6 digits, 1,0,4,2,0 and 7 respectively; the second part has 2 digits, 2 and 9 respectively.
Calculate Digit Verification of CAS Registry Number 104207-29:
(8*1)+(7*0)+(6*4)+(5*2)+(4*0)+(3*7)+(2*2)+(1*9)=76
76 % 10 = 6
So 104207-29-6 is a valid CAS Registry Number.

Process for preparing 2,4-dichloro-3-alkyl-6-nitrophenols

2-4-Dichloro-3-alkyl-6-nitrophenols which are useful as intermediate of cyan couplers in color photography are prepared by sulfonating 4-chloro-3-alkyl-phenols to obtain 5-chloro-4-alkylhydroxybenzenesulfonic acids, chlorinating the acids in an aqueous phase to obtain 3,5-dichloro-4-alkyl-2-hydroxybenzenesulfonic acids and nitrating the sulfonic acids.
